Comparison Table for WEL Series Economical GC Columns
| Column Name | Phase Type | Stationary Phase | USP | Similar / Equivalent To |
| WEL-30 | Non-polar phase | 100% Dimethyl polysiloxane | G2 | DB-1, HP-1, DB-1ms, HP-1ms, Rtx-1, Rtx-1ms, SPB-1, InertCap 1, BP-1 |
| WEL-5 | Low polarity | 5% Diphenyl, 95% dimethyl polysiloxane | G27 G36 | DB-5, HP-5, Rtx-5, SPB-5, InertCap 5 |
| WEL-17 | Mid-polarity | 50% diphenyl, 50% dimethyl polysiloxane | G3 | DB-17ms, VF-17ms, Rtx-50, Rxi-17Sil MS, InertCap 17, InertCap 17MS, Zebron ZB-50, ZB-17m, Optima-17, Optima-17ms |
| WEL-FFAP | Polar phase | Nitroterephthalic acid modified polyethylene glycol | G35 | DB-FFAP, HP-FFAP, Stabilwax-DA, NukolTrajan / SGE: BP21, InertCap FFAP, CP-Wax 58 CB |
| WEL-PEG20M | Polar | Polyethylene glycol 20M (PEG-20M) | G16 G3 | DB-WAX, HP-INNOWax, Stabilwax, Zebron ZB-WAX, InertCap WAX / InertCap Pure WAX, Carbowax 20M, PEG-20M |
| WEL-101 | Non-polar | 100% Dimethyl polysiloxane (Non-polarity) | G2 | DB-1, HP-1, HP-101, Rtx-1, SPB-1, OV-101, BP-1, CP-Sil 5 CB |
| WEL-1301 | Low to mid-polarity | 6% cyanopropylphenyl, 94% dimethylpolysiloxane | G43 | DB-1301, DB-624, HP-1301, VF-1301ms, Rtx-1301, Rtx-624, InertCap 1301, InertCap 624, TG-1301MS, TG-624, SPB-1301, SPB-624 |
| WEL-1701 | Moderate polarity | 14% Cyanopropylphenyl, 86% dimethyl, methylpolysiloxane | G46 | DB-1701, HP-1701, Rtx-1701, SPB-1701, BP10, ZB-1701, Optima-1701, InertCap 1701, InertCap 1701MS, CP-Sil 19 CB |
| WEL-225 | Mid to high polarity | (50%-cyanopropylphenyl) dimethylpolysiloxane | G7 | DB-225, HP-225, Rtx-225, SPB-225, BP-225, OV-225, CP-Sil 43 CB, AT-22 |
| WEL-23 | High polarity | 50% cyanopropyl, 50% methyl polysiloxane | G5 G48 | Rtx-2330, BPX70, SP-2330, SP-2340, DB-23 |
| WEL-35 | Medium polarity | 35% phenyl, 65% methyl polysiloxane | G42 G28 G32 | DB-35, HP-35, SPB-35, Rtx-35, InertCap 35, Optima 35 MS |
| WEL-52 | Low-polarity | 5% phenyl, 95% dimethylpolysiloxane | G27 G36 | DB-Wax, DB-WAX UI, DB-WAXetr, HP-INNOWax, Stabilwax, Rtx-Wax, Supelcowax 10, ZB-Wax, SH-Wax, SH-PolarWax, InertCap WAX, InertCap Pure-WAX, BP-20 |
| WEL-54 | Low-polarity | 5% phenyl, 95% dimethylpolysiloxane | G27 G36 | HP-5, DB-5, HP-5ms, Rtx-5, ZB-5 |
| WEL-624 | Low to mid-polarity | 6% cyanopropylphenyl, 94% dimethylpolysiloxane | G43 | DB-624, VF-624ms, Rtx-624, Rxi-624, Sil MS, Zebron ZB-624, Elite-624, InertCap 624 |
| WEL-bpx-70 | High polarity | 70% cyanopropyl polysilphenylene- siloxane | G5 | DB-23, Rtx-2330, CP-Sil 88, SP-2330, SP-2380, SP-2460, HP-23 |
| WEL-INOWAX | High polarity | polyethylene glycol (PEG) | G16 | HP-INNOWax, DB-WAX, Stabilwax, Rtx-Wax, ZB-WAX, Supelcowax-10, InertCap Pure-WAX, InertCap WAX |
| WEL-PLOT Al2O3 | mid-polarity | porous aluminium oxide (alumina) | - | HP-PLOT Al2O3 KCl, GS-Alumina KCl, and CP-Al2O3/KCl, Rt-Alumina BOND/KCl, SH-Alumina BOND/KCl |
| WEL-PLOT Al2O3/S | mid-polarity | aluminium oxide (Al₂O₃) deactivated with sodium sulfate ("S") | - | CP-Al2O3/Na2SO4 and HP-PLOT Al2O3, Rt-Alumina BOND/Na2SO4, TG-BOND Alumina (Na2SO4), GsBP-PLOT Al2O3 "S", DM-PLOT Alumina / Na2SO4 (Alumina Sulfate PLOT) |
| WEL-PLOT Q | Non-polar | 100% Divinylbenzene polymer (porous polymer network) | S3 | HP-PLOT Q, Rt-Q-BOND, CP-PoraPLOT Q / CP-PoraBOND |
| WEL-PONA | Non-polar | 100% Dimethyl polysiloxane | G2 | HP-PONA, Petrocol DH / Petrocol DH 50.2, Rtx-1 PONA / Rtx-DHA, Zebron ZB-Petro, BP1 PONA |
| WEL-TVOC | High polarity | dedicated WEL-TVOC proprietary stationary phase | DB-WAX, CP-Wax 52CB, Stabilwax, Supelcowax 10 [5.11], InertCap WAX [5.11, 5.15] | |
| WEL-WAX | High polarity | polyethylene glycol (PEG) | G16 | DB-WAX, HP-INNOWax, CP-Wax 52 CB, Rtx-Wax, Stabilwax, Supelcowax-10, BP-20 (TraceGOLD TG-WaxMS), OPTIMA WAX |
| WEL-XE60 | Moderate polarity | 25% cyanoethyl, 75% methylpolysilicone | G26 | XE-60 / Rt-XE-60 |
